Lazio eye move for former Blues striker

Serie A club Lazio interested in landing the signature of Nicolas Anelka from West Bromwich Albion on a six-month deal during the winter transfer window.
Anelka's future with the Baggies had come under scrutiny in recent weeks following his controversial 'quenelle' gesture during his goal celebration in the club's 3-3 draw against West Ham United last month.
The former Chelsea man is understood to have appealed against the charge of misconduct filed against him by the Football Association, but Sky Sport Italia report that the Baggies could allow the sale of the talented striker, as they face the prospect of losing out on their main sponsors due to the controversy.
Lazio are open to a six-month deal for Anelka, who is keen on signing an 18-month contract at the least.
Anelka joined the West Midlands outfit on a free transfer in the summer.
